1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

The Three Fifths Compromise was about

Back

The way that slaves would be counted in the census for representation and tax purposes

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

The major complaint of the Anti Federalists was that the new revised Constitution would

Back

give the federal (central) government too much power and that it did not list a bill of rights

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

The Great Compromise was a decision that

Back

Created a bicameral Congress

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

The idea that no one is above the law, not even the president, is known as

Back

Rule of Law

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

The idea that each of the three branches have powers/ways to put limits on the other two branches is known as

Back

checks and balances

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Idea that absolute power rests with the people (people rule)

Back

Popular Sovereignty

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Separating a government's power into 3 branches of government.

Back

Separation of Powers
